Digit
n., humanoid.Agility Robotics, United States, 2019. A warehouse humanoid built for the handling of totes; among the first of its kind to work paid shifts, logging over one hundred thousand cycles. In production.
Digit descends from the springy bird legs of Cassie, developed at Oregon State University and commercialised by Agility Robotics. It became the first humanoid to work a paid customer shift, moving totes for GXO Logistics in 2024, and Amazon has trialled it in research facilities. Agility's RoboFab plant in Oregon was announced as the first factory purpose-built for humanoids.
- Height
- approx. 175 cm
- Payload
- approx. 16 kg
- Endurance
- approx. 90 min per charge
- Deployments
- GXO Logistics; Amazon trials
